I don't post a whole lot on here, I usually read mostly. But I figured I would throw this out there to see if anyone could tell me what my problem is. I have an 87 that is N/A with a 5 speed. All of the emissions have been removed including the BAC. Sometimes when reving the car in neutral, the idle surges. You can hold the gas in one spot and it will surge up and down about 500 rpms. It's not a big deal, but I would like to fix it. It doesn't do it all of the time, like sometimes it will go away while it is surging. Any ideas? Thanks, Vincent. |
